Notes
--> BR Edrich (1) passed 3500 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 19
--> TH Clark (1) passed 1000 runs in First-Class matches for the season when he reached 39
--> TG Evans (2) passed 1000 runs in First-Class matches for the season when he reached 51
--> TG Evans (2) passed 5000 runs in County Championship matches when he reached 41
--> TG Evans (2) passed 8000 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 35
--> S O'Linn (2) passed his previous highest score of 98 in County Championship matches
--> S O'Linn (2) made his first century in County Championship matches
--> S O'Linn (2) passed his previous highest score of 98 in First-Class matches
--> S O'Linn (2) made his first century in First-Class matches
--> S O'Linn (2) passed 1000 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 1
--> AV Bedser (2) passed 4000 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 8
--> WS Surridge reached 50 wickets in First-Class matches for the season when taking his 7th wicket in the Kent first innings
--> AV Bedser reached 550 wickets in County Championship matches when taking his 2nd wicket in the Kent second innings

S O'Linn kept wicket in he Surrey second innings as Evans was off the field with a hand injury
